The most straightforward kind of cat flap, is just that. A hole in a door with a flexible piece of material fixed over it, to provide protection from the weather, but allow the cat pass through. Although this could be suitable for a shed or outhouse door, most Hedge End cat owners would doubtless favour something a tad more secure and weatherproof for an exterior door to their property.

Since this solution can allow other cats or creatures to enter your house, it isn't at all ideal, although it can be improved on to some extent by keeping the flap in place by adding magnetic strips.

Magnetically operated, infra-red or RF chip designs of cat flap, are a step up from the basic magnetic strip version. With these, either an IR, RF chip or magnet will be sewn into your cat's collar. No animal will be able to leave or get into your property unless it is equipped with this special collar. Once again this is a fairly simple form of cat flap, given that any other cat in the area that has a similar collar may be able to gain access to your house. RF cat flaps and collar systems are the upgraded version of these products as they can be programmed by the owner of the cat to recognise a unique identifier, distinct to your pet. An additional layer of control and security is achieved, guaranteeing that only your purrfect companion gains access.

Fitting a cat flap that can be operated by your cat's own microchip, is the next level in entry security for felines in Hedge End. You need to enter the number of your cat's microchip into the cat flap's memory (which is powered by batteries), and if you have more than one pet it will take multiple entries. Whenever your cat is in close proximity to the flap, it will unlock and permit solely your micro-chipped pets to use the exit/entrance.

Whenever you are buying a cat flap, you must make certain that it's of a design that can be locked. For added security, almost all cat flaps have a four way locking mechanism nowadays. Which means it's got the capability to enable only exit from your home, be locked fully, enable admittance into your home only, or be put in two-way exit and entry mode. This provides you with a range of solutions on precisely how your cat flap works at all times of the day and night time. A few high end cat flaps can be programmed to perform specific functions in accordance with the time of day, in line with your cat's and your needs.

If you've got a timber door on your property in Hedge End, putting in you own cat flap should not be too difficult. On no account should you try and fit a cat flap in a reinforced uPVC door or in a double glazed window. These sorts of fixtures call for a professional installation from a trustworthy cat flap installer or odd job man with the appropriate equipment and skills.

Double Glazing Installations - If your new cat flap is going to be mounted on a double glazing window or door panel, and your hired "tradesman" endeavours to drill a hole in it, stop them straight away and give them their marching orders. It isn't possible to mount a new cat flap into a double glazed window pane or door panel. Any sort of double glazed unit will be ruined by cutting or drilling into it, and will diminish its strength, thermal attributes and security. It should under no circumstances be attempted and renders your double glazing unsound.

It is necessary to obtain a new double glazing unit made specially for this purpose by a glazing company, and your local Hedge End cat flap fitter will take the measurements of your current panel and put in an order for a brand new one. To ensure that your cat flap can be nicely fitted into it, this new double glazed unit will arrive with a hole pre-cut as a part of its structure. This is really the only way to install a cat flap in an existing patio or double glazed door, although it might take two weeks or so to manufacture. Once you have taken possession of your new panel of glass, the old one can be removed and the new one fitted. It will now be possible to fit the new cat flap.

uPVC Door Panels - uPVC doors can be used for installing a cat flap. However, some uPVC door panels are steel lined for further security, which may cause some problems. The easiest type of installation is in doors having one single panel, consequently if you've got a uPVC door with slatted vertical panels, it may be easier and cheaper overall to exchange the slatted pane for a one piece panel.

Wall Installation - It's also a possibility to get a cat flap fitted into an external wall of your property in Hedge End, if you do not want to have a hole cut in one of your doors, for safety or aesthetic reasons. This sort of installment is certainly better left to a specialist, since it calls for a lot more equipment and skill to accomplish. You can go for a straight through tunnel style, or even a right angle model which enables entry through a pillar. With this type of installation a plastic or metal, open ended square tube is inserted into a square hole cut out of your selected wall. Both ends of the hole are then fitted with an appropriate cat flap so your feline friend can get out of and into your home whenever it wants.

Replacing an Existing Cat Flap in Hedge End - If your door, window or wall is already fitted with a cat flap, but it has stopped working, or is damaged, it's possible to fit a replacement into the current cavity. An experienced Hedge End cat flap installer will be glad to take out your old unit and replace it with a new cat flap without inflicting any damage on the window, door or wall on which it's mounted.

If the substitute cat flap is going to be fitted in a pre-cut hole in a double glazing panel, you must make sure that the existing glass has been made and installed correctly. If it is found that this isn't the case, and corners were cut in the original installation, the glass pane must be removed and replaced with a new one to avoid any security and safety problems.
